
Minneapolis-Moline GTC Tractor
The Minneapolis-Moline GTC tractor, produced in 1951 – 1953 in United States, is a compact and reliable machine. It features a 70 HP Minneapolis-Moline 5.6L 4-CYL LP gas engine, a 25 GAL fuel tank, and a maximum speed of 6-12 MPH. The original price in 1951 – 1953 was $2,500.
